Sony Bravia Theatre System 6 Review: Immersive Cinema Sound with Minor Trade-Offs

Overview
The Sony Bravia Theatre System 6 is a complete 5.1-channel home theatre setup, including a soundbar, subwoofer, and rear speakers. Priced at ₹49,990 in India, it offers 1,000W power output and aims to deliver premium cinema-like sound without the hassle of mixing components.


Design & Setup

  • Soundbar: 907 x 64 x 90mm, 2.6kg
  • Subwoofer: 275 x 388 x 388mm, 11.6kg
  • Rear Speakers: 106 x 216 x 98mm, 0.89kg
  • Amp Box: 175 x 52 x 175mm, 0.76kg

The system has a minimalist black design. The subwoofer acts as the hub, handling source connections and distributing signal to the soundbar and rear speakers. The rear speakers are “wireless” in audio but still require power via a small amp box. Setup is straightforward, though planning for speaker placement and power access is necessary.


Connectivity & Features

  • Audio Channels: 5.1, 10 speaker units
  • Audio Formats: Dolby Atmos, DTS:X (virtualised)
  • Inputs: HDMI ARC/eARC, optical, analogue, USB
  • Wireless: Bluetooth 5.3 (SBC, AAC)
  • Audio Modes: Soundfield processing, Multi-Stereo, Voice Zoom

The system relies on virtual surround effects rather than dedicated up-firing height channels. While it fills a room well and adds immersion, true 3D overhead effects are simulated, not actual.


Performance
The Bravia Theatre System 6 excels with movies, shows, and live sports:

  • Dialogue clarity: Strong centre channel ensures voices are always audible.
  • Bass & effects: Subwoofer delivers punchy lows for explosions and music, though can be loose or overpowering at high volumes.
  • Surround experience: Rear speakers add depth; immersive but occasionally artificial.

For music, the system is less impressive. Stereo tracks lack layering and precise tonal balance; bass-heavy music can feel bloomy. Overall, it’s cinema-first, music-second.


Pros & Cons

Pros:

  • Complete 5.1 setup in one box
  • Powerful subwoofer and immersive sound
  • Clear dialogue and strong soundstage
  • Simple cabling for the soundbar

Cons:

  • No Wi-Fi or network streaming
  • No dedicated height channels
  • Rear speakers require power and careful placement
  • Bulky subwoofer occupies floor space

Verdict
The Sony Bravia Theatre System 6 is a strong all-in-one home theatre solution. It’s ideal for movie enthusiasts seeking cinematic sound without assembling multiple components. While it has some compromises—especially for music lovers or those wanting advanced streaming—it delivers a clean, powerful, and immersive audio experience. For most users, it’s one of the better 5.1 options available in 2025.
